Output 6a8d71622cb0255e5a5a358f4a66a0e8591077426e7baafd2221307071befa83:5

value
28167127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d35fe0aba04d32fa3cf5edc5a76d1d16114f926 OP_EQUAL
address
MAZcWSuyFmkx8GnQokqKU88wLsNm2ufV3m
transaction
6a8d71622cb0255e5a5a358f4a66a0e8591077426e7baafd2221307071befa83
spent
true